Using a 3/4" flat brush, paint the top rim of the pot in Melonball.
Using a 3/4" flat brush, begin painting the pot starting at the top with Melonball and go down approximately 1/3 of the way. While the paint is still wet, use the same brush (no need to rinse) and brush on Turquoise Waters around the middle, making sure to overlap with Melonball.
While the paint is still wet, use the same brush (no need to rinse) and brush on Deep Turquoise around the bottom, making sure to overlap with Turquoise Waters.
Using a 3/4" flat brush, paint the two wooden dowels in Melonball.
Using the pattern, cut three pennants/triangle shapes from the burlap.
Using a 3/4" flat brush, loosely paint the pennants with Deep Turquoise. (Do not paint to the edges.)
Use a pencil to loosely draw "MOM", with one letter on each pennant. Using a #8 round brush, paint the shape of the letter "block style" in Melonball. Rinse brush and paint "MOM" in Cobalt. Use a hot glue gun to adhere the pennants to a piece of twine. Tie knots in between the pennants. Tie the pennants to the painted dowels.
Fill the pot with beauty supplies/spa items. Stand the dowels inside on either side of the pot. (Refer to photo for placement.)
